How they compare
Uganda currently reports 10.19 units per square kilometre against 9.93 units per square kilometre in Luxembourg, a difference of 0.26 units per square kilometre.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 24 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Luxembourg ahead.
Luxembourg ranks 50th and Uganda ranks 48th of 216 countries.
Luxembourg has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

About this data
Population ages 25-29, male divided by Land area (sq. km), matched on country and year. Neither publisher issues this ratio as a series; it is computed here from both.
